How blind people use batlike sonar Science AAAS

Web11. nov 2014 · Unlike bats' large, mobile ears, however, human ears are small and fixed—an obstacle to blind people who use their ears to "see." To test the extent to which people can compensate for this immobility, Wiegrebe and colleagues recruited eight undergraduates with normal vision to don blindfolds and learn some basic echolocation skills. Web22. dec 2015 · Bats have been recognized as the natural reservoirs of a large variety of viruses. Special attention has been paid to bat coronaviruses as the two emerging coronaviruses which have caused unexpected human disease outbreaks in the 21st century, Severe Acute Respiratory Syndrome Coronavirus (SARS-CoV) and Middle East Respiratory … sector 12 bokaro pin code
